Various Historical sites can provide the perfect spot for a Lake Tahoe Wedding. The majority of them are situated right next to the beautiful blue waters of this Alpine lake. Valhalla south lake tahoe was constructed in the early 1900's and the fine wood craftsmanship creates an alpine feel. Thunderbird Lodge was recently opened to the public and is situated in a private part of the east shore. Ehrman Mansion on the West Shore of Tahoe is another wonderful spot.
